Experian Health is pleased to announce that we went live with Patient Estimates at St. Clair Hospital located in Pittsburgh, PA on February 22, 2016. A true representation of vendor and hospital collaboration and commitment, the Patient Estimates cost transparency tool gives St. Clair a competitive edge as the first hospital in its region to offer patients cost estimates in advance. Patient Estimates is not a list of charges, but an interactive and user-friendly tool that provides information that is highly specific to the individual. Estimates are designed to determine, in advance, each patient’s out-of-pocket costs (deductibles, co-pays and co-insurance) for services at St. Clair based upon his/her insurance coverage. The estimates also incorporate St. Clair’s discounts for payment on the date of service and for those without insurance. The estimates remain in the system and can be recalled for future reference. Patient Estimates is simple to use and is conveniently available 24/7 at www.stclair.org. On the home page, patients will select the “Financial Tools” option, then click on Patient Estimates. They will then enter their health insurance information before choosing one of the 100 listed clinical services (e.g., a procedure, treatment or diagnostic test) from the drop-down menu. The tool then provides a customized estimate of their out-of-pocket expenses. Patient Estimates is designed to help insured and uninsured patients get clear, real-time, easy-to-understand cost estimates for St. Clair’s services so patients can make informed decisions about their care. The title of Best in KLAS is a highly coveted recognition of outstanding efforts to help healthcare professionals deliver better patient care. It is reserved for vendor solutions that lead the software and services market segments with the broadest operational and clinical impact on healthcare organizations. ~KLAS Enterprises LLC Last month, Experian Health’s eCare NEXT® platform was awarded the highest score in the Patient Access category of the 2015/2016 Best in KLAS: Software & Services report. This is the 5th straight year Experian Health has received the highest ranking in the patient access category—3 years as Category Leader in Patient Access – Eligibility Checking and now 2 years Best in KLAS in the broader Patient Access category. The KLAS award confirms our strong commitment to continually provide advanced technology and revenue cycle products for our clients, and consistently develop enhancements and new solutions with them. We are proud of the collaboration between our progressive clients and our dedicated employees to ensure clients provide the best patient care experience, and achieve payment certainty for every patient. It’s a great honor that our clients continue to hold Experian Health’s solutions in such high regard that we have been recognized consistently by KLAS year after year. Episode management, particularly the 30-90 days post-discharge, is incredibly important for all types of healthcare entities seeking to succeed under value-based reimbursement. Millions of dollars in revenue, shared savings, and bundled payment contracts are at-risk when hospitals, ACOs, bundled payment conveners, and others don’t have visibility into their patient’s care after hospital discharge. Leading health care organizations are realizing the solution is not simply to hire an army of care managers, but rather, to supplement a care management team with focused automation to double or triple their productivity by sharing workflow and care management with the patient’s community providers, including independent MD offices, skilled nursing facilities (SNFs), home health agencies (HHAs), and others. Having the right care solutions in place is critical to ensuring successful episode management.
